CNN Central News & Network-ITDC India Epress/ITDC News Bhopal: NCP (Sharad Pawar faction) MLA Rohit Pawar launched a sharp political attack on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Eknath Shinde following the Mahayuti alliance’s unexpected defeat in the Nashik Legislative Council election. Using the phrase “the hunter has been hunted,” Pawar suggested that the setback marked a significant reversal for Shinde, who has often been viewed as a key strategist in Maharashtra’s shifting political landscape.
The remarks came after BJP rebel candidate Gokul Gite secured a surprise victory over the Mahayuti-backed candidate Narendra Darade in the Nashik Local Authorities constituency. The result has sparked intense political debate, with opposition leaders portraying it as evidence of growing dissatisfaction and internal divisions within the ruling alliance.
Pawar argued that the outcome demonstrated that political tactics used against opponents could eventually backfire on those employing them. His comments were widely seen as a direct reference to the series of defections and political realignments that have reshaped Maharashtra politics in recent years.
The Nashik MLC result is being viewed as politically significant because the constituency was considered favorable to the ruling alliance. Analysts believe the defeat may intensify discussions about alliance management, internal coordination, and future electoral strategies as Maharashtra’s political parties prepare for upcoming contests.
